Aradea Putra Pangestu is a researcher specializing in robotics and industrial automation, with a particular focus on embedded control systems and sensor-based sorting technologies. His most cited work, "Perancangan Dan Implementasi Sistem Kendali Lengan Robot Penyortir Barang Berdasarkan Warna" (2016), presents the design and implementation of a robotic arm control system for color-based object sorting—a contribution that addresses the growing demand for efficient, automated machinery in Indonesian industries. This paper, with 4 citations, demonstrates his early impact in applying practical robotics solutions to real-world manufacturing challenges.
